Preparation of copper-iron bimodal pore catalyst and its performance for higher alcohols synthesis
چکیده انگلیسی

A multi-functional silica–silica bimodal pore catalyst support was prepared from silica sol and silica gel, which presented two kinds of main pores. Compared to the original silica gel, the obtained bimodal support had the enlarged surface area and decreased pore volume. This kind of bimodal pore support was applied firstly in higher alcohols synthesis, where both the copper and iron elements were supported as active sites. The bimodal pore catalyst exhibited favorite catalytic activity and high selectivity of C2+OH, due to the well dispersion of active metal sites and high diffusion efficiency of products inside the bimodal pore structures.
